9 For we know in part and we prophesy in part; 10 but when the perfect should come, the partial will be made null. 11 When I was a child, I was speaking like a child, I was thinking like a child, I was reasoning like a child; when I became a man, I have made null the things of the child. 12 For now we see through a glass in obscurity, but then, face to face. Now I know in part, but then I will know fully, even as I have been fully known. 13 But now these three things remain: faith, hope, love; but the greatest of these is love. 1 Corinthians 13:9-13, Berean Literal Bible.
